Xiaozhan Jin is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Electrical and Electronic Engineering and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ics. According to data from OpenAlex, Xiaozhan Jin has authored 10 papers receiving a total of 836 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 10 papers in Materials Chemistry, 7 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ering and 6 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ics. Recurrent topics in Xiaozhan Jin’s work include Graphene research and applications (10 papers), Advancements in Battery Materials (5 papers) and Quantum and electron transport phenomena (3 papers). Xiaozhan Jin is often cited by papers focused on Graphene research and applications (10 papers), Advancements in Battery Materials (5 papers) and Quantum and electron transport phenomena (3 papers). Xiaozhan Jin collaborates with scholars based in South Korea, Hungary and Belgium. Xiaozhan Jin's co-authors include Chanyong Hwang, Z. Osváth, Péter Nemes‐Incze, László Péter Biró, Péter Vancsó, Levente Tapasztó, Imre Hagymási, Muhammad Waqas Iqbal, Jonghwa Eom and Muhammad Zahir Iqbal and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Carbon and ACS Applied Materials & Interfaces.
